Hiroshi Fujiwara Announces fragment design x NEIGHBORHOOD Capsule
Alongside Japan tour dates.

Following Moncler’s announcement of Hiroshi Fujiwara as a part of the “Moncler Genius” lineup, the Japanese streetwear king took to social media sharing another upcoming collaboration — this time with streetwear label NEIGHBORHOOD. The collection is meant to be merch for Hiroshi’s upcoming “Slumbers Live 2018” coinciding with his latest album, titled Slumbers. In one post, the designer/musician is seen rehearsing in a new fragment “SLUMBERS” tee. Meanwhile, a second post confirms a tour with the artist sporting a black/white hoodie decorated with the iconic fragment logo sitting on top on a dog outline on the front and NEIGHBORHOOD logo on the back.
Performances are slated for February 28 in Sendai and March 1 in Tokyo. Captions suggest the collaboration will be released on Farfetch.com likely to coincide with the aforementioned dates.
